C语言作为一门经典的编程语言,在计算机科学教育中占据着重要地位。然而,对于许多学习者来说,C语言考试中的难题往往成为他们的绊脚石。本文将为您提供一些高效解题技巧,帮助您告别死记硬背,轻松应对C语言考试中的难题。
一、理解基础知识,构建知识框架
1.1 数据类型与变量
在C语言中,数据类型是理解其他概念的基础。掌握整型、浮点型、字符型等基本数据类型及其使用方法至关重要。
1.2 运算符与表达式
运算符是C语言中用于进行数学运算、逻辑判断等的符号。熟悉各种运算符的优先级和结合性,有助于解决复杂的计算问题。
1.3 控制结构
C语言中的控制结构包括顺序结构、选择结构和循环结构。熟练掌握这些结构,能够使您的程序更加灵活。
二、培养编程思维,提高逻辑分析能力
2.1 理解算法
算法是解决问题的关键。学习C语言时,要注重算法的理解和掌握。通过分析问题,找出合适的算法,然后将其转化为代码。
2.2 代码调试
编程过程中,代码调试是必不可少的环节。掌握一些调试技巧,如使用断点、单步执行等,能够帮助您快速定位并解决问题。
2.3 编程规范
遵循良好的编程规范,使代码更加清晰、易于阅读和维护。例如,合理使用缩进、注释等。
三、实战演练,积累经验
3.1 练习题目
通过大量的练习题目,可以巩固所学知识,提高解题能力。可以从简单的题目开始,逐步提高难度。
3.2 参加比赛
参加C语言编程比赛,可以锻炼您的编程能力,提高心理素质。同时,与其他选手交流,可以学习到更多的解题思路。
3.3 实际项目
尝试参与实际项目,将所学知识应用到实际编程中。这样不仅能够提高编程能力,还能增强团队合作意识。
四、总结与展望
掌握C语言考试难题的解题技巧,需要您在基础知识、编程思维、实战演练等方面下功夫。通过不断学习和实践,相信您能够告别死记硬背,轻松应对C语言考试中的难题。
在未来的学习中,希望您能够:
- 深入理解C语言的基本概念和原理。
- 培养良好的编程思维和逻辑分析能力。
- 积极参与实战项目,提高编程水平。
- 与他人交流学习,拓宽知识面。
祝您在C语言学习道路上越走越远!
